Abstract

A pair of hydraulic cylinders 10 which are coupled to a driven member, placed parallel to each other and extend/contract in synchronization with each other, and a control valve 20 which controls hydraulic fluid supplied to or discharged from the hydraulic cylinder 10 are provided. An elastic support mechanism 50 which supports the control valve 20 to each hydraulic cylinder between the paired hydraulic cylinders 10 ; metallic piping 30 and the metallic piping 40 which connect the control valve 20 with the respective hydraulic cylinders 10 and leads the hydraulic fluid controlled by the controlling valve 20 ; and curved portions 31 c , 32, 41 c , 42 a which are provided at some midpoints of the piping and flexibly deform in accordance with relative deformation of each hydraulic cylinder 10 are provided. A difference in relative displacement of each hydraulic cylinder with respect to the control valve 20 is absorbed by deformation produced in the elastic support mechanism 50 and the curved portions.

Claims (21)

1. A hydraulic cylinder apparatus, comprising:

a pair of hydraulic cylinders that are coupled to a driven member, are placed parallel to each other, and extent/contract in synchronization with each other;

a control valve that controls supply/discharge of hydraulic fluid from/to the pair of the hydraulic cylinders;

an elastic support mechanism that supports the control valve to each of the pair of the hydraulic cylinders between the pair of the hydraulic cylinders;

metallic piping that connects the control valve and each of the pair of the hydraulic cylinders and leads hydraulic fluid controlled by the control valve; and

curved portions that are provided at some midpoints of the metallic piping and flexibly deform in accordance with relative displacement of each of the pair of the hydraulic cylinders, wherein:

a difference in the relative displacement of each of the pair of the hydraulic cylinders with respect to the control valve is absorbed.

2. The hydraulic cylinder apparatus according to claim 1 , wherein:

the pair of the hydraulic cylinders are located on both sides of the driven member, and the control valve and the metallic piping are placed symmetrically with respect to a center line between the pair of the hydraulic cylinders.

3. The hydraulic cylinder apparatus according to claim 2 , further comprising:

a base plate on which the control valve is mounted, wherein:

the base plate is placed between the pair of the hydraulic cylinders and is coupled to each of the pair of the hydraulic cylinders through the elastic support mechanism provided on both sides of the base plate.

4. The hydraulic cylinder apparatus according to claim 3 , wherein:

the control valve is mounted on a face of the base plate opposite to the driven member.

5. The hydraulic cylinder apparatus according to claim 3 , wherein:

the metallic piping includes piping connected to one of hydraulic pressure chambers of the pair of the hydraulic cylinders and piping connected to the other of the hydraulic pressure chambers of the pair of the hydraulic cylinders, wherein:

in each piping, the curved portions are curved within an approximate right angle range on surfaces forming right angles with each other.

6. The hydraulic cylinder apparatus according to claim 5 , wherein:

the metallic piping is formed by connecting a single pipe connected to the control valve and a pair of branch pipes which are connected respectively to the pair of the hydraulic cylinders, and the curved portion provided in the single pipe and the curved portion provided in each of the branch pipes are located on surfaces at right angles to each other.

7. The hydraulic cylinder apparatus according to claim 6 , wherein:

the single pipe includes the curved portion curving in a U shape, and is connected respectively to the pair of the branch pipes on the rear face of the control valve.
